Job Description:
JOB SUMMARY: In addition to managing a substantial arbitration
case load, this role works with the leadership team to assure that
the arbitration team meets its performance metrics, quality
performance, and business objectives. This role manages an
arbitration case load including evaluation of provider disputes and
appropriate client payment offers. The incumbent will coordinate
efforts with the team and leadership to bring matters to efficient
and successful outcomes. JOB ROLES AND RESPONSIBILITIES: 1. Perform
weekly Soft Audits on cases work by team members and address
performance issues.
2. Identify, design and execute training needs on an individual
basis. Discuss training needs for the team with manager and provide
continuous coaching of the staff so they perform at the highest
levels.
3. Perform additional administrative tasks such as monitoring team
chat's or emails for questions, participate in team meetings for
response to team questions or help identify issues.
4. Host weekly or bi-weekly Team Huddles for case discussion and
review.
5. Prepare written analyses of disputed provider/health plan
positions and persuasively document arguments supporting client
positions in arbitration packages pursuant to federal
regulations.
6. Conduct due diligence (e.g. online research, portal and
application research) to assist with the analysis and preparation
of arbitration packages.
7. Works with other departments to develop or obtain information
necessary for the submission of IDR packages.
8. Review and analyze clinical information along with documents
submitted by providers of moderate to high complexity.
9. Meet federal filing deadlines and turn around times
10. Respond timely to all electronic, written and verbal
communications, log information derived from written and verbal
communication; maintain detailed and accurate records.
11. Outreach to clients for data needed for arbitration
packages
12. Maintain department productivity and quality standards
13. Sensitivity to privacy in accordance with HIPAA guidelines
14. Collaborate, coordinate, and communicate across disciplines and
departments.
15. Ensure compliance with HIPAA regulations and requirements.
16. Demonstrate Company's Core Competencies and values held
within.
